#fa0c58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#fa0c58 is composed of 98% red, 4.7%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 64.8% yellow and 2% black. It has a hue angle of 340.8 degrees, a saturation of 96% and a lightness of 51.4%. #fa0c58 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ff18b0 with #f50000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

#fa0c58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#fa0c58 has RGB values of R:250, G:12,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.95, Y:0.65,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 16387160.

Shades and Tints of #fa0c58
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070002 is the darkest color, while #fff3f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#fa0c58
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#887e81 is the less saturated color, while #fa0c58 is the most saturated one.
